Q: I’ve heard that mail carriers aren’t allowed to accept tips. How can I thank mine? A: According to the U.S. Postal Service, employees may receive gifts valued at $20 or less, per occasion. Since some people like to give throughout the year, it’s worth nothing that there’s a $50 annual cap per giver. Also [...]
